George J. McConchie
"Buck"
1929 – 2025
George J. McConchie age 96, of Springfield, died peacefully April 10, 2025, surrounded by his immediate family. George, who went by "Buck" is survived by his loving wife of 68 years, Mary Pat; his daughters Laurie (Mark) and Becca (Mark); his niece Mary (Mark); and his affectionate cat Puff. Buck was predeceased by his oldest daughter Betsy.
As a young man, Buck was a member of the Christian Brothers, a congregation whose purpose and people he was close with throughout his life. After leaving the Brothers, Buck married Mary Pat and graduated from law school. He practiced as a trial attorney for 50 years with his Media, PA firm of Cramp, D'Iorio, McConchie, and Forbes. Buck loved sports, both cheering the professional Philly teams and playing the amateur variety he shared with his family – tennis, running, swimming, sailing, and scuba (and a pretty unsuccessful run at skiing). He was an avid bridge player, achieving the rank of Silver Life Master. Buck also enjoyed music; he cantered at St. Dorothy's church in Drexel Hill and sang in local concerts with the University Glee Club. Later in life, Buck enjoyed studying languages and practicing his guitar (and was the first to confess that "studying" and "practicing" are not necessarily the same as "learning.") He was as honest as they come and generous to the core; a loving man who will be sorely missed.
